But here are some rules to keep in mind when chatting with people online: #1 - People can be ANYTHING THEY WANT TO BE online. That guy who describes himself as a single, 30 year old, 6'1' 205 lb, airline pilot, hung with a 9" meat missle, 6-pack ab'ed, stud muffin, may, in fact, be a married 50 year old accountant who's 5'6", 240'lbs, with a 6 pack of beer and a 4" weenie. This leads us to rule #2 - Take NO ONE, and I mean NO ONE, at face value. Even Me! *lol* Make them PROVE they are who and what they say they are. GET REFERENCES! Not just emails but either physical address for snail mail contact or telephone numbers. Once you get the references, check them out. #3 - Look for involvement in their community. Either online or realtime. It's hard to fake a personality over long periods of time. For example, if Joe Dominant has absolutely nothing more than a profile up, I'd have serious questions about their involvement in the community. Anyone who claims XX number of years of experience will have someone, somewhere, who will vouche for them. If they can't give you some independent contacts, they are hiding _something_ from you, for whatever reason. Take that for what it's worth. If they are who and what they claim to be, they can back it up with something more than "meet me at the Motel No-Tell and I'll prove what a good dominant I am!" YIK, - Geoff
